What Are the Key Factors to Consider When Choosing the Best Electric Skateboard for Hills?

When choosing the best electric skateboard for hills, several key factors should be considered to ensure performance and safety.

  • Motor Power: A powerful motor is essential for climbing hills effectively. Look for electric skateboards with a motor rated at least 750W or higher, as these can provide the torque necessary to ascend steep inclines without straining the battery.
  • Battery Capacity: The battery capacity determines how far you can ride and how much power is available for hill climbing. Opt for a skateboard with a high-capacity battery (measured in Wh) to ensure longer rides and the ability to tackle multiple hills without depleting your power.
  • Weight Capacity: Each skateboard has a maximum weight limit that should not be exceeded for optimal performance. Choose a model that can comfortably support your weight, as exceeding this limit can lead to decreased performance, especially on inclines.
  • Wheel Size and Type: Larger wheels can handle uneven terrain better and provide a smoother ride when climbing hills. Look for skateboards with wheels that are at least 90mm in diameter and made from high-quality urethane for improved grip and durability.
  • Braking System: A reliable braking system is crucial when riding downhill or after climbing a hill. Consider models with regenerative braking or electronic brakes, as these provide better control and safety when descending steep gradients.
  • Deck Material and Design: The material and design of the deck can affect the skateboard’s overall stability and comfort. A wider deck made from durable materials like bamboo or composite offers better balance, especially on inclines, while also being lightweight.
  • Speed Settings: Multiple speed settings allow for better control on hills, as you can choose a lower speed for climbing and a higher speed for flat terrain. Look for skateboards that offer adjustable speed options, catering to both novice riders and experienced skaters.
  • Portability: If you plan to carry your electric skateboard uphill or store it in tight spaces, consider its weight and folding capabilities. Lightweight models or those that can be easily folded are more convenient for users who need to transport their skateboards.

How Important is Motor Power in Climbing Steep Terrain?

Motor power plays a critical role in determining the performance of electric skateboards on steep terrain.

  • Torque: The amount of torque generated by the motor is essential for climbing hills effectively.
  • Wattage: Higher wattage motors can provide more power, which translates to better performance on inclines.
  • Battery Capacity: A strong battery is necessary to support high motor power over extended climbs without depleting quickly.
  • Weight Capacity: The motor power must be adequate to handle the total weight of the rider and the skateboard.
  • Gear Ratio: The gear system can enhance the efficiency of the motor’s power delivery, affecting hill climbing capabilities.

Torque: Torque is the rotational force that the motor can exert, which is crucial for overcoming gravity on steep inclines. A skateboard with high torque can accelerate quickly and maintain speed even when faced with challenging slopes, making it ideal for hill climbing.

Wattage: The wattage of the motor directly affects the power output of the electric skateboard. Higher wattage motors, typically ranging from 1000 to 3000 watts, provide the strength needed to ascend steep hills without significant loss of speed, ensuring a smooth ride.

Battery Capacity: A skateboard’s battery must be able to support the motor’s power demands, especially during tough climbs. If the battery capacity is low, riders may find themselves running out of power before reaching the top of a hill, making battery choice a vital factor for hill climbing performance.

Weight Capacity: Each electric skateboard has a specified weight limit that includes both the rider and the board itself. When the combined weight exceeds the skateboard’s capacity, the motor has to work harder, which can lead to overheating and decreased performance on steep terrain.

Gear Ratio: The gear ratio influences how efficiently the motor’s power is transferred to the wheels. A well-designed gear system can increase torque at lower speeds, allowing the skateboard to conquer steep gradients without straining the motor excessively.

What Role Does Battery Capacity Play in Hill Climbing Performance?

  • Power Output: Higher battery capacity allows for more power to be delivered to the motor, which is crucial when tackling steep inclines.
  • Motor Efficiency: A battery with a larger capacity can maintain voltage levels, ensuring the motor operates efficiently even under load, which is vital for uphill performance.
  • Range and Endurance: Increased battery capacity extends the skateboard’s range, allowing riders to ascend hills without the fear of running out of power mid-climb.
  • Weight Considerations: Larger batteries often add weight, which can affect overall performance; however, the trade-off may be worth it for better hill climbing ability.
  • Charge Time: Higher capacity batteries typically require longer charging times, which can impact convenience but may provide the necessary energy for challenging terrains.

Power Output refers to the ability of the skateboard to generate sufficient energy to overcome gravitational forces when climbing hills. A skateboard with a higher capacity battery can supply more watts to the motor, providing the necessary torque to ascend steep grades effectively.

Motor Efficiency is influenced by the ability of the battery to sustain voltage during demanding conditions. When climbing hills, maintaining a consistent voltage ensures that the motor can deliver optimal performance without stalling or losing power.

Range and Endurance are critical for riders who plan to navigate hilly terrains. A skateboard equipped with a larger battery can sustain longer rides without depleting power, allowing users to complete their journeys, including uphill sections, without interruption.

Weight Considerations play a dual role; while larger batteries can enhance performance, they also add weight to the skateboard, which can affect handling and maneuverability. Riders must find a balance between battery capacity and skateboard weight for optimal performance.

Charge Time becomes an important factor as well; larger batteries generally take longer to charge, which can be inconvenient for users who need quick turnaround times. However, the extended range and climbing capabilities may justify the longer wait for many riders.

What Safety Measures Should You Take When Riding Electric Skateboards on Hilly Terrain?

When riding electric skateboards on hilly terrain, it’s crucial to implement specific safety measures to ensure a safe and enjoyable experience.

  • Wear Protective Gear: Always wear a helmet, knee pads, elbow pads, and wrist guards to protect yourself in case of falls.
  • Check Your Skateboard’s Specs: Ensure that your electric skateboard is designed for hill climbing, with a powerful motor and sufficient battery capacity.
  • Practice Speed Control: Familiarize yourself with the throttle and braking systems to maintain control, especially on steep inclines and declines.
  • Choose the Right Route: Always select routes that match your skill level and the capabilities of your skateboard, avoiding excessively steep or uneven surfaces.
  • Inspect Your Skateboard: Regularly check the condition of your skateboard, including brakes, wheels, and battery, to prevent mechanical failures while riding.
  • Ride with a Buddy: Whenever possible, ride with a friend who can provide assistance in case of an accident or if you encounter difficulties.
  • Stay Aware of Your Surroundings: Be vigilant about obstacles, pedestrians, and traffic, particularly in hilly areas where visibility might be limited.
  • Use Appropriate Lighting: If riding at dusk or night, ensure your skateboard is equipped with lights to enhance visibility for both you and others.

Wearing protective gear is essential as it greatly reduces the risk of injury in the event of a fall, which is common when navigating hills. Plus, using knee pads, elbow pads, and wrist guards can help prevent scrapes and more serious injuries.

Checking your skateboard’s specifications is vital because not all electric skateboards are built to handle steep inclines. A board with a powerful motor can better manage the demands of climbing hills, while a robust battery ensures you have enough power for your ride.

Practicing speed control is crucial on hilly terrain; understanding how your skateboard responds to throttle and brakes can help you maintain balance and prevent accidents. This skill is particularly important when descending steep hills, where speed can quickly become unmanageable.

Choosing the right route involves selecting paths that match both your skill level and the technical capabilities of your skateboard. Avoiding steep, rocky, or uneven terrain can help minimize the risk of accidents.

Regularly inspecting your skateboard ensures that all components are functioning properly, which is essential for safe riding. Pay special attention to the brakes and wheels, as any malfunction could lead to dangerous situations, especially on hills.

Riding with a buddy adds an extra layer of safety; having someone else around can be invaluable in case of an emergency. It also creates an opportunity for shared experiences and learning from each other.

Staying aware of your surroundings is paramount, especially in hilly areas where visibility can be compromised. Being alert to potential obstacles and other riders enhances your ability to navigate safely.

Using appropriate lighting at night or in low-light conditions is critical for your visibility and can help prevent accidents. Lights not only make you more visible to others but also illuminate your path, helping you avoid hazards.
